Scope: Shopwright product catalog, invalidation layer only.

Invalidation keys are derived from SKU hash plus region shard. Reviewers: confirm the purge fanout no longer bypasses the warm-tier on partial updates — that regression shipped twice. Provenance for each deploy is pinned to the artifact digest, not the branch tag; tags are mutable, digests are not. Do not approve merges that touch the TTL constants without a provenance entry. Every approved change must cite the build token appended below.

build token for kagaf-hahof: htk14_9d3d4d26d7d8de

# Who to Contact: Image Slimming (Project Pareflat)

Pareflat owns the base-image slimming pipeline. If a review touches Dockerfiles, multi-stage builds, or the distill step, route questions to the Pareflat maintainers rather than guessing. They approve changes to the allowlist of retained binaries and any deviation from the slim base. Typical turnaround is one business day. For anything blocking a merge, send the PR link and failing layer report to the team inbox.

escalation mailbox, fafof-bahip: tamael@ordincorp.test

MEMO — Quillbrook Term Sheet

To all heads of department: we have received a term sheet from Quillbrook Holdings proposing a minority investment with board observer rights. Counsel is reviewing the exclusivity and information-access clauses carefully, as both carry operational implications. Please route any Quillbrook enquiries to Selwyn directly and make no external comment. The strategic rationale is summarised in the confidential note below.

board note of tadup-tajog: Headcount on the Oliiel team goes from 31 to 88 by the end of February. Gross margin on Oliiel came in at 62 percent against a plan of 29 percent.